Introduction

The journey of cycling products from local markets to global export is a fascinating process that encompasses innovation, strategy, and the pursuit of sustainability. As the cycling industry expands, understanding this journey can unlock new avenues for businesses looking to thrive in international trade.

The Local Cycling Market: A Starting Point

Every successful export journey begins at home. Local markets serve as testing grounds for new cycling products, where manufacturers can gather valuable feedback and refine their offerings. Engaging with local cycling communities can provide insights into consumer preferences and help tailor products to meet market demands.

Building a Reliable Supply Chain

Establishing a strong supply chain is vital for successful exports. Partnering with local manufacturers who meet quality standards can ensure that products are ready for international markets. Transparent supply chains build trust, which is essential for fostering long-term partnerships with overseas clients.

Transitioning to Global Markets

Once a product is established in local markets, the next step is to transition to global export. Understanding international trade regulations, tariffs, and customs procedures is crucial to navigate this complex landscape. Collaborating with export consultants and legal experts can ease this transition and help mitigate risks.

Marketing Strategies for Global Reach

To succeed in global markets, robust marketing strategies are essential. Businesses must create targeted campaigns that resonate with diverse audiences worldwide. This includes optimizing digital marketing efforts through SEO, social media engagement, and content marketing to boost visibility and attract potential clients.

Emphasizing Sustainability in Exports

As global awareness of environmental issues increases, sustainability has become a key selling point in the cycling industry. Exporting businesses that prioritize eco-friendly practices, such as sourcing sustainable materials and reducing carbon footprints, can enhance their appeal in international markets.

Conclusion

The journey of cycling products from local markets to global export is an intricate process that requires strategic planning and execution. By understanding the nuances of the export landscape, businesses can effectively navigate the challenges and capitalize on the opportunities that arise in the ever-expanding world of cycling products.
